What You’ll Need for These Thanksgiving Nail Designs

Before we jump into the designs, let’s make sure you have the right tools. Here’s what I recommend for creating stunning Thanksgiving nail art:

  • Warm autumn polishes – Burgundy, burnt orange, mustard yellow, deep brown
  • Base and top coat – Essential for long-lasting wear
  • White or cream polish – For contrast and delicate details
  • Gold or bronze polish – For that festive shimmer
  • Fine nail art brush – For detailed designs and line work
  • Dotting tool – For creating dots, leaves, and patterns
  • Striping tape – For crisp, clean lines
  • Matte top coat – To transform glossy polish into velvety elegance
  • Glitter polish – For that extra sparkle
  • Rhinestones or studs – For glamorous accents

With these basics, you’re ready to create every design in this guide!

1: Classic Cranberry Red Glossy Nails

Cranberry red is the quintessential Thanksgiving color. It’s rich, warm, and absolutely stunning on every skin tone.

Apply two coats of a deep cranberry red polish, allowing each layer to dry completely. Finish with a high-shine top coat for that gorgeous glossy finish that catches the light beautifully.

2: Burnt Orange Matte Finish

Burnt orange is the color of falling leaves and pumpkin patches. It’s warm, inviting, and perfect for Thanksgiving.

Apply two coats of burnt orange polish and let them dry completely. Then, seal with a matte top coat. The velvety finish transforms the warm orange into something truly special and sophisticated.

3: Adorable Pumpkin Accent Nails

Pumpkins are the ultimate Thanksgiving symbol. Adding a tiny pumpkin to your accent nail is playful, festive, and surprisingly easy.

Start with a nude or cream base on all your nails. On your accent nail, use orange polish to paint a small pumpkin shape. Add a tiny green stem and a curled vine with a thin brush. The result is absolutely adorable.

4: Cozy Plaid Pattern Nails

Plaid is the ultimate cozy pattern. It reminds us of warm blankets, fall flannels, and crisp autumn days.

Start with a matte burgundy or brown base. Using a fine brush, paint thin vertical and horizontal lines in gold, cream, or orange. The intersecting lines create a classic plaid pattern that’s both stylish and festive.

6: Gold Foil Accents on Warm Tones

Gold foil adds a touch of luxury and warmth to any Thanksgiving manicure. The shimmering accents catch the light beautifully.

Paint your nails with a deep burgundy or warm brown polish. Once dry, apply small pieces of gold foil to one or two accent nails. Press them down gently and seal with a glossy top coat for a smooth finish.

8: Tortoiseshell Pattern Nails

Tortoiseshell is having a major moment, and it’s surprisingly perfect for Thanksgiving. The warm browns and amber tones capture the season’s cozy essence.

Apply a warm amber or caramel base. Using a thin brush, dab small spots of dark brown and black polish randomly. While still wet, gently blend the spots together with a clean brush for that signature tortoiseshell effect.

9: Thanksgiving Glitter Gradient

Glitter gradients add a touch of festive sparkle to your Thanksgiving manicure. They’re glamorous without being overwhelming.

Apply a warm autumn base color like deep burgundy or burnt orange. Using a makeup sponge, dab gold or bronze glitter polish onto the tips, fading it out toward the cuticle. The result is a beautiful gradient that sparkles like autumn sunlight.

Pro Tips for Long-Lasting Thanksgiving Nails

Now that you’ve created your stunning Thanksgiving nail art, here’s how to keep it looking fresh through all the festivities:

  • Prep your nails properly. Start with clean, dry nails and gently push back your cuticles.
  • Use a base coat. This protects your nails and helps the polish adhere better.
  • Apply thin layers. Thin layers dry faster and are less likely to chip.
  • Seal the edges. Swipe the brush along the free edge of your nail to prevent chipping.
  • Reapply top coat. Add a fresh layer of top coat every few days to maintain shine.
  • Protect your hands. Wear gloves when doing dishes or cleaning.
  • Be careful with hot foods. Hot dishes can cause your polish to soften and smudge.
